Skilled Worker going rate
This role likely qualifies for a Skilled Worker visa
SOC 3131 (85% match) is an eligible occupation, with a going rate of £41,700, and 2 Sisters Food Group is a licensed sponsor. That is our reading of the rules. Whether they issue a Certificate of Sponsorship is still their call.
Worth checking: this could also be SOC 4159 (Other administrative occupations not elsewhere classified., If the role is purely administrative with no IT systems work), which is not on the eligible-occupation list. Ask 2 Sisters Food Group what the duties actually are.
IT Administrator
Location: Wakefield (Hybrid)
Working Hours: 08:30-17:00
About Us:
Join 2 Sisters Food Group, one of the UK's largest food manufacturers, with an annual turnover exceeding £3 billion and approximately 13,000 employees across multiple sites. We have a strong presence in poultry, chilled, and bakery food categories. We are committed to delivering high-quality products to the British public and our customers including major retailers like Aldi, Co-op and Marks & Spencer.
About the Role
We're looking for a highly organised and detail-focused IT Administrator to join our team at 2 Sisters Food Group.
This is a hands-on administrative IT role, focused on ensuring our systems, accounts, permissions and IT assets are accurately maintained. You'll play an important role in supporting the smooth onboarding and offboarding of colleagues, as well as keeping our IT records up to date.
